H

hmm permission denied normally means that either your login details are incorrect or maybe cox restricts access to their mail server (so you have to be logged in from a cox connection or similar)

The easiest thing would probably be to switch to a free host that allows mail. See Hosts, Hosting and Commercial Services or FreeWHT
